Trump hits Canada with 50% tariff

ALBAWABA - The Tariff President, Donald Trump, continues to impose tariffs on friends and enemies alike, the latest being Canada with a hefty tariff of 50 percent. The move comes in response to Trump’s perceived ‘unequal treatment’ of U.S. cars, dairy, and alcohol by Canada; tariff targets ranged from everyday goods such as wine and hockey sticks to industrial goods like cement.
